In summer, forest fires are a common landscape view in Himachal Pradesh which have affected an area of over 2,600 hectares of green cover with over 500 incidents causing damage to property in the state. Worse so, the incidents are increasing by the day at an alarming rate in and around Shimla town. Forest officials say most fire incidents are started by human action. For instance, the local villagers tend to set grasslands afire to get softer grass after the rains. In most cases, the fire from grasslands spreads to nearby forests.... See more
